Frequently asked

Straight answers to the questions this page exists to answer.

Who won the NOAPARA assembly constituency in 2026?

Arjun Singh (BJP) won NOAPARA in 2026, by a margin of 17,656 votes.

Which party has won NOAPARA the most times?

CPM, with 8 of the 16 wins recorded since 1962.

How many times has NOAPARA gone to the polls?

16 times, from 1962 to 2026.

Who has won NOAPARA the most times?

MANJU BASU, with 3 wins between 2001 and 2021.
